Spring Festival at the Monument returns April 13

March 20,2024

The annual Spring Festival at the Monument returns to downtown Enterprise Saturday, Apr. 13 from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. with fun for all ages, vendors, food trucks, live music and more!

The festival this year will focus on an art theme and will include unique entertainment.

“In addition to a juggler on unicycle performing throughout the event grounds, we are so excited to welcome Jonboy Storey to our event to provide live music at the stage on East College Street,” Main Street Executive Director Mariah Montgomery said. “His country music will fill the streets of downtown and provide a new element to our popular spring-time event.”

More than 100 vendors are expected to line Main Street, as well as booths with free children’s activities.  Free train rides, inflatables and face painting will also be available. FFA will provide free seed planting activities for kids.

“Spring Festival at the Monument would not be possible without our sponsors: All In Credit Union, Parker Loan Team, Waxing the City, C-Spire, Beacon of Hope, Southeast Health, Five Star Credit Union, Capital Tractor and Envoy Mortgage,” Montgomery said. “We are incredibly grateful for their support of this event which allows our community, especially families, to enjoy a fun day, free of charge, in the heart of our city.”

More than 25 food vendors will be spaced throughout the event on Sessions field, East Street and Grubbs Street. Tables and chairs will be set up for patrons to utilize.  Volunteers will set up a photo op at the monument and help visitors take their group photos.
